Output 13aa57851176c787d8c7f82b45f7d097b6e476624cc08cec60c236848abf5040:1

value
761668
script pubkey
OP_0 OP_PUSHBYTES_20 8aab595f9d0af52dcdbc911054f07e7c2e925e90
address
bc1q3244jhuapt6jmndujyg9fur70shfyh5s5ajpua
transaction
13aa57851176c787d8c7f82b45f7d097b6e476624cc08cec60c236848abf5040
spent
true